British Academy Project Induction Held in Pokhara

PHASE Nepal team successfully held a project induction workshop on the British Academy funded project named

“Developing women’s role in policy-making processes: shaping gender equity and inclusiveness in climate action for health and wellbeing in Nepal”,

with the senior stakeholders of Pokhara Metropolitan City one of the two local levels partners of this project. This project is jointly implemented by PHASE Nepal and Liverpool School of Tropical Medicine, UK.  The induction programme was organized on the 20th of July, 2024 to discuss the project plans and budgets with the stakeholders. The participants of the programme comprised of executive members of the metropolis such as Deputy Mayor, and Chiefs of the Social Development, Health, Education and Planning Departments. The officials have provided creative and constructive feedbacks on how we implement the project.

” Please include Female Community Health Voluteers (FCHVs) and the members of Health Facility Operation and Management Committee (HFOMC) to explore the ground issues so that we can bring them to the policy dialogues”, suggested the chief of the health section.

“Please also corodinate with the environment section of the metropolis as this project is related to the climate change”,  said the deputy mayor.
